So, why should you prefer professional investment support today?
- Market volatility
From breaching an all-time high in January 2020 to falling more than 30%1 in just 2 months in March 2020, to a slow and steady recovery in the last few weeks despite considerable growth in the pandemic causalities. This severe market volatility can confuse you as to when to buy and sell investments. A professional advisor can help you make sense of this market volatility to drill down to the value proposition of different investments.
- Complexity of investing options
Today we have a wide range of investment products to choose from – from traditional fixed deposits to various debt instruments to a plethora of equity options. Not only do we have to map our goals with our investments but must also analyse the investment types vis-à-vis the state of the economy to be able to gauge its risk-reward potential. An uncertain and unstable economy makes this already complex task more difficult and a professional investment advisor can make this task considerably simpler.
- Potential to earn better
The ultimate goal of all investing is wealth multiplication. Outsourcing your investment decisions to professional advisors has the potential to earn you relatively better returns than you probably could if you were to invest on your own.
- Filtering out the emotions in investing
Have your regretted hastily selling your investments when the markets began to fall just to see them rise considerably a few months later?
This is where professional advice can prove its might. Investing decisions taken based on your emotions, without rationally evaluating the merits involved can often prove to be incorrect. A professional analysis of the market movements is likely to be based on a value analysis as opposed to an emotionally tainted analysis.
- Pro-active
Investing is a continuous process and not a one-time exercise. As a novice investor you may make the effort to do a detailed analysis while initially investing your money, but could find it difficult to be consistently updated with the economic happenings in the country and across the globe. It is the job of a professional advisor to be abreast with the state of the economy and markets, putting him in an advantageous position to monitor your portfolio.
